Flavor and Texture
The first thing I care about is taste. I want a sauce that has a deep tomato base, a creamy finish, and the right balance of spices like garam masala, cumin, and ginger. Texture matters too—I like it thick enough to coat the protein well, but not so thick that it feels heavy or pasty.
Ingredients and Nutrition
I always read the label carefully. If I am trying to eat healthier, I look for lower sodium, less added sugar, and fewer artificial additives. Since tikka masala sauce can vary a lot by brand, I compare nutrition facts so I know what I am bringing home.
Value for Money
One reason I consider Costco is value. I like buying in bulk when I know I will use the product often. For me, the best choice is a sauce that offers a good price per ounce and stays fresh long enough for me to finish it before it expires.
How I Use It at Home
I usually use tikka masala sauce as a shortcut for weeknight dinners. I heat it with cooked chicken, tofu, chickpeas, or vegetables and serve it with rice or naan. I also like to add a little cream, yogurt, or extra spices if I want to adjust the flavor to my liking.
Storage and Shelf Life
I always check whether the sauce needs refrigeration after opening and how long it lasts once opened. Since Costco sizes are often larger, shelf life matters to me. I want to be sure I can store it properly and use it before it goes bad.
